Accademia Gallery

Right in the heart of Florence lies the famous Accademia Gallery, an absolute must-see for all art and culture enthusiasts. The museum is one of the most important in the world and houses some of the greatest masterpieces of the Renaissance. Here you can admire Michelangelo's world-famous original statue of David – a highlight for art lovers. 

Palazzo Vecchio

In the heart of Florence, right on Piazza della Signoria, stands the imposing Palazzo Vecchio, one of the city's most famous landmarks. The greatest artists of the Renaissance, including Vasari, created impressive frescoes and ornate decorations here. Today, visitors can explore the magnificent halls, secret passages, and the famous Hall of the Five Hundred. The tower of the Palazzo Vecchio also offers a spectacular view over the rooftops of Florence.

Chianti Wine Tour

The picturesque Chianti region is just a stone's throw from Florence and is a true paradise for wine lovers. Numerous tours start directly from Florence and take you through the rolling hills of Tuscany, past olive groves and medieval villages. Along the way, you will visit historic wineries, learn fascinating details about wine production, and enjoy fine wines during a tasting. Whether you choose a half-day tour or a full-day excursion, the Chianti wine tour combines enjoyment, culture, and beautiful landscapes for an unforgettable experience.

Day trip to Pisa

Just 50 minutes from Florence lies Pisa, a city famous for its world-renowned landmark: the Leaning Tower. A day trip from Florence is the perfect opportunity to discover Piazza dei Miracoli, where you will find not only the tower but also the magnificent cathedral and baptistery. Stroll through the charming alleys of the old town, enjoy an espresso in one of the cozy cafés, and let yourself be enchanted by the flair of this historic city. Thanks to its short travel time, Pisa is ideal for a relaxing trip that combines culture and Italian lifestyle.
